Cammie's mom is the headmistress of the Gallagher Academy, Rachel Morgan. Her father's name is Matthew Morgan. He went on a mission, and never came home. That is all we know about Mr.Morgan as of right now.

In "I'd Tell You I Love You But Then I'd Have To Kill You", Cammie is 15. In "Cross My Heart And Hope To Spy" and "Don't Judge a Girl By Her Cover", she is 16. And In "Only The Good Spy Young", she is 17.
